The average cost of living in San Juan del Rio is $826, which is in the top 32% of the least expensive cities in the world, ranked 6343rd out of 9294 in our global list and 45th out of 144 in Mexico.

The median after-tax salary is $711, which is enough to cover living expenses for 0.9 months. Ranked 7526th (TOP 81%) in the list of best places to live in the world and 57th best city to live in Mexico. With an estimated population of 301K, San Juan del Rio is the 58th largest city in Mexico.
